Overview

 

The programmes have been developed by some of the travel industry's top course writers. The result is a fresh contemporary approach and a thoroughness for which Virgin is famous. The objective is to provide training programmes leading to valuable qualifications that demonstrate professional competence on the part of the holder; qualifications that not only improve the promotion and employment prospects of the student, but also help build the staff skills-base that will ensure the long term continued expansion of the wider tourism and travel sectors. Both programmes are accredited by City & Guilds as part of their Tourism qualifications.

 

Launched in 2003, the Virgin Atlantic/GTMC Fares and Ticketing Level 1 and Level 2 programmes set the standard in manual Fares and Ticketing training for people who want to enhance their travel industry skills or join the travel industry. Centres can run any of the programmes below.


Fares and Ticketing Level 1

Level 1 introduces you to the world of the travel industry. By using extracts from selected industry publication, students will be taught how to price and document various itineraries, according to the customer's requirements.
 

On completion of this module, students will be able to:

  • Define IATA geographical areas and Global Routing Indicators
  • Interpret various airline codings
  • Identify differing fare types and their characteristics
  • Select the lowest applicable fare for point to point itineraries with reference to fare rules
  • Calculate fares applying the fundamental principles of the mileage system
  • Construct fares using NUCs and the IATA Rates of Exchange for a range of currencies
  • Interpret all ticket types
  • Interpret all MPDs/MCOs
 

Fares and Ticketing Level 2


This has been designed to give you a thorough understanding of fare construction principles, building on the Level 1 knowledge with step by step stages of new principles of fare construction, which enables you to calculate and recognise more complex fares.


On completion of this module, students will be able to:

  • Construct fares for multi-sector journeys, applying the mileage system, higher intermediate points and minimum fare checks
  • Apply add-ons to construct unpublished fares
  • Calculate fares for journeys with surface sectors

  • Calculate fares for journeys involving side trips

  • Assess fares for journeys involving different classes of service

  • Construct special fares for multi-sector journeys with and without surface sectors

  • Complete automated and manual fare calculation areas in detail

     

Virgin Atlantic/GTMC Train the Trainer

Centres are required to have suitably qualified and experienced trainers to teach on CTH programmes. CTH offers appropriate training for the Virgin Atlantic/GTMC Fares and Ticketing programmes on request.

 

The duration of the course required will be assessed on each trainer's previous experience. Please contact Travel Programmes for further details at travel@cthtraining.com
